Power Up Your Workouts: A Guide to Pre-Workout Supplements and Nutrition

Jordan Logan |

Introduction: A successful workout begins even before you step into the gym. Pre-workout preparation, including proper nutrition and supplementation, plays a crucial role in maximizing your energy levels, focus, and performance. In this blog post, we will explore the benefits of pre-workout supplements and nutrition, along with tips for selecting the right products and foods to power up your workouts.

  1. The Benefits of Pre-Workout Supplements and Nutrition Proper pre-workout nutrition and supplementation can provide numerous benefits, such as:

    a. Enhanced energy and endurance b. Improved mental focus and concentration c. Increased muscle strength and power d. Reduced muscle fatigue and soreness e. Optimized nutrient delivery and absorption

  2. Key Ingredients in Pre-Workout Supplements When choosing a pre-workout supplement, consider products that contain the following ingredients:

    a. Caffeine – for increased energy and alertness b. Beta-Alanine – to reduce muscle fatigue and improve endurance c. Citrulline Malate – for enhanced blood flow and oxygen delivery d. Creatine Monohydrate – to boost strength and power e. Branched-Chain Amino Acids (BCAAs) – to support muscle recovery and reduce muscle breakdown

  3. Pre-Workout Nutrition In addition to supplements, it's essential to fuel your body with the right nutrients before a workout. Aim to consume a meal or snack consisting of:

    a. Complex carbohydrates – for sustained energy release, such as whole grains, fruits, or starchy vegetables b. Lean proteins – to support muscle repair and growth, such as chicken, turkey, or plant-based protein sources c. Healthy fats – for long-lasting energy and nutrient absorption, such as avocados, nuts, or seeds

  4. Timing Your Pre-Workout Nutrition To optimize the benefits of your pre-workout nutrition, consider the following guidelines:

    a. Consume a well-balanced meal 2-3 hours before your workout b. If you prefer a lighter snack, eat it 30-60 minutes before exercising c. Take pre-workout supplements as directed, typically 20-30 minutes prior to your workout

Conclusion: A well-planned pre-workout routine, including proper nutrition and supplementation, can significantly enhance your exercise performance and overall results. By fueling your body with the right nutrients and supplements, you'll be better equipped to power through your workouts and achieve your fitness goals.
